What customers say
This campsite offers a lovely location with direct access to the Tissington Trail. Visitors praise the friendly and helpful staff, clean facilities, and spacious pitches. The on-site swimming pool and playground are particularly popular with families. While generally well-maintained, some mention dated toilet facilities and occasional issues with noise or cleanliness. The pods and bell tents receive positive feedback for comfort and amenities.
